Best time to go

The best time to visit Death Valley is during the spring or fall, when the temperatures are milder. However, it is important to note that Death Valley is a desert, and temperatures can reach extreme highs during the summer months.

Where to Go

There are a number of things to see and do in Death Valley, including:

  • Badwater Basin: This is the lowest point in North America, at 282 feet below sea level.
  • Zabriskie Point: This is a popular viewpoint that offers stunning views of the Death Valley landscape.
  • Dante's View: This is another popular viewpoint that offers views of the Panamint Mountains and the Racetrack Playa.
  • Artist's Drive: This is a 9-mile scenic drive that takes you through a colorful landscape of canyons and mountains.
  • Golden Canyon: This is a popular hiking trail that takes you through a narrow canyon with sheer walls.
